What Is the Alexapure Pro?

The Alexapure Pro is a gravity-fed water purification system manufactured by Alexapure, a brand positioned in the emergency preparedness and off-grid living market. Unlike electric-powered filtration systems that require plumbing connections, the Alexapure Pro operates entirely on gravity. You pour untreated water into the upper chamber, and over the course of an hour or so, filtered water collects in the lower chamber, ready for dispensing through a spigot.

The unit is constructed entirely from 304 stainless steel, which means no plastic components contact your drinking water at any point. This is a meaningful distinction for buyers concerned about plastic leaching, microplastics, or BPA exposure. The stainless steel body also gives the unit substantial durability - it is designed to last decades with proper care, and the 5-year warranty backs that claim.

At 8.5 inches in diameter and 21.5 inches tall, the Alexapure Pro occupies roughly the same footprint as a large countertop appliance. It weighs approximately 10 pounds when empty, making it portable enough to move between locations but substantial enough that you will not want to relocate it daily. The 2.25-gallon capacity splits roughly evenly between the upper and lower chambers, meaning you can have about one gallon of filtered water available at any given time while the next batch filters through.

The Alexapure Pro sits squarely in the category of emergency preparedness and daily-use hybrid filters. It is marketed heavily toward households that want clean drinking water without depending on municipal treatment infrastructure, making it popular among preppers, rural homeowners, and families concerned about boil-water advisories or aging municipal pipes.

How the 4-Stage Filtration Works

The Alexapure Pro uses a single ProOne-style filter element that combines four distinct filtration stages into one cylindrical cartridge. Understanding each stage helps clarify what the filter actually does and where its limitations lie.

Stage 1: Ceramic Pre-Filter

The outermost layer is a porous ceramic shell with extremely fine pores rated to 0.2 microns. This mechanical filtration stage physically blocks sediment, rust, particulate matter, bacteria, cysts, and larger pathogens from passing through. The ceramic surface is impregnated with silver, which adds bacteriostatic properties that prevent bacterial growth on the filter itself - an important consideration for gravity filters that operate at room temperature over extended periods.

Stage 2: Activated Carbon

Inside the ceramic shell, a layer of activated carbon adsorbs chlorine, chloramine byproducts, volatile organic compounds (VOCs), pesticides, herbicides, and chemicals that cause unpleasant tastes and odors. The carbon has a massive surface area relative to its volume, giving it substantial capacity for chemical adsorption. However, because the carbon is enclosed within the ceramic shell rather than being a standalone stage, its total volume is smaller than what you would find in a dedicated carbon block filter.

Stage 3: Zeolite

Zeolite is a naturally occurring mineral with a crystalline structure that traps heavy metals through ion exchange. In the Alexapure filter, zeolite targets lead, mercury, cadmium, and other positively charged metal ions, exchanging them for harmless sodium or potassium ions. This stage is particularly relevant for households served by older plumbing infrastructure where lead leaching is a concern.

Stage 4: Silver-Impregnated Media

The final stage uses silver-impregnated granular media that provides additional bacteriostatic protection. Silver ions disrupt bacterial cell membranes and prevent biofilm formation within the filter element. This is not the same as killing viruses directly, but it significantly reduces the risk of bacterial colonization inside the filter cartridge during periods of inactivity.

The key advantage of this all-in-one design is that fluoride removal is built into the same element that handles bacteria, lead, and chemicals. With Berkey systems, you must purchase separate PF-2 fluoride add-on filters at an additional cost of roughly $70 per pair, which attach to the Black Berkey elements inside the lower chamber. The Alexapure eliminates this complexity and extra expense by integrating everything into one cartridge.

Contaminant Removal Claims vs. Reality

Alexapure publishes independent lab test results claiming reduction of over 200 contaminants. The company emphasizes that these tests were conducted by third-party laboratories, but it is critical to understand that the Alexapure Pro is not NSF or ANSI certified. NSF certification involves rigorous, standardized testing protocols with ongoing audits and verification. Independent lab testing, while valuable, does not carry the same regulatory weight or consistency guarantees.

The claimed removal percentages are impressive on paper:

  • Fluoride: 99.9% reduction
  • Lead: 99.9% reduction
  • Bacteria: 99.9999% reduction (6-log)
  • Viruses: 99.99% reduction (4-log)
  • Chlorine: 99.9% reduction
  • Chloramines: 99.9% reduction
  • Heavy metals: 99.9% reduction (mercury, cadmium, chromium)
  • VOCs and pesticides: 99.9% reduction
  • Pharmaceuticals: 99.9% reduction

In practical terms, a 99.9% fluoride reduction means that water containing 1.0 parts per million (ppm) of fluoride would exit the filter at approximately 0.001 ppm - well below the EPA maximum contaminant level of 4.0 ppm and the recommended optimal level of 0.7 ppm. For lead, a 99.9% reduction would take water at the EPA action level of 15 parts per billion (ppb) down to 0.015 ppb, which is effectively negligible.

However, buyers should note that independent lab tests are typically conducted under controlled conditions with specific challenge concentrations. Real-world performance varies based on your actual water chemistry, pH, temperature, flow rate, and the age of the filter element. The 99.9999% bacteria claim (6-log reduction) is particularly important for households using well water or those concerned about microbiological contamination during infrastructure failures.

The lack of NSF certification is the most commonly cited criticism of the Alexapure Pro. NSF/ANSI Standard 53 covers health-related contaminants like lead and cysts, while Standard 42 covers aesthetic contaminants like chlorine and taste. Standard 401 addresses emerging contaminants including pharmaceuticals. Without these certifications, buyers must trust the manufacturer's independent research or conduct their own water quality verification using home test kits.

Real-World Performance and Flow Rate

The Alexapure Pro's rated flow rate of 1.0 gallon per hour is significantly slower than the Berkey Big's 2.5 gallons per hour per element. In practice, this means filling the upper chamber before bed and having filtered water ready in the morning works fine, but trying to filter large quantities on demand requires patience.

Several factors affect the actual flow rate you will experience. New filters flow faster initially and slow down as the ceramic pre-filter accumulates sediment. Hard water with high calcium and magnesium content can gradually reduce flow rates as mineral scale builds on the ceramic surface. Periodic cleaning of the ceramic shell with a scouring pad under running water restores most of the original flow - Alexapure recommends this maintenance every few months depending on water quality.

The 2.25-gallon total capacity is adequate for couples or small families but can feel limiting for larger households. A family of four consuming the recommended half-gallon of drinking water per person per day would need to run at least two full cycles daily to keep up with demand, not counting water used for cooking, coffee, or pets. The single-filter configuration means you cannot increase throughput by adding elements - the chamber is designed for one cartridge only.

Water taste after filtration receives consistently positive feedback from owners. The combination of ceramic filtration and carbon adsorption effectively removes the chlorine taste and odor present in most municipal water supplies. Users switching from refrigerator filters or basic pitcher filters typically notice a cleaner, crisper taste immediately.

Cost Analysis: Price Per Gallon

Understanding the true cost of any water filter requires looking beyond the sticker price. The Alexapure Pro breaks down as follows:

ItemCost
Initial unit purchase$279
Replacement filter element$60
Filter capacity per element5,000 gallons
Cost per gallon (filter only)$0.012
Cost per gallon (amortized with unit)~$0.048

The amortized cost per gallon assumes you replace the filter once and divide the total investment ($279 + $60 = $339) across 10,000 gallons of filtered water. Over multiple filter replacements, the unit cost becomes less significant and the per-gallon cost approaches the filter-only rate of $0.012.

For comparison, bottled water costs roughly $1.00 to $3.00 per gallon depending on brand and packaging. Premium pitcher filters like the Brita Longlast+ run about $0.15 to $0.20 per gallon. Reverse osmosis systems typically fall in the $0.05 to $0.15 per gallon range when maintenance is factored in. The Alexapure Pro sits comfortably among the most economical options, especially for a system that requires no electricity and no plumbing.

Over a 10-year ownership period assuming two filter replacements per year (a conservative estimate for average municipal water), total ownership costs would be approximately $279 + ($60 x 20) = $1,479 for 100,000 gallons of water, yielding a lifetime cost per gallon under $0.015.

Alexapure Pro vs. Berkey Big vs. Propur Big

The gravity filter market essentially comes down to three main competitors. Here is how they stack up on the metrics that matter most:

FeatureAlexapure ProBerkey BigPropur Big
Price$279$367$279
Fluoride removalBuilt-in (all-in-one)Requires PF-2 add-on (+$70)Built-in (ProOne G2.0)
Flow rate (per element)1.0 GPH2.5 GPH1.2 GPH
Filter capacity5,000 gal6,000 gal3,000 gal
Max elements143
CertificationIndependent labIndependent labNSF 42, 61
Warranty5 yearsLifetime1 year

The Berkey Big commands a higher price but delivers faster filtration and the flexibility to add up to four Black Berkey elements, pushing total output to 10 gallons per hour. For large families or situations where speed matters, this scalability is a meaningful advantage. However, the $367 base price does not include fluoride removal, so the true comparison price is closer to $437. Berkey also benefits from the largest dealer network and decades of market presence, meaning replacement parts and support are widely available.

The Propur Big matches the Alexapure on price and also includes built-in fluoride filtration, but uses the ProOne G2.0 element which carries NSF 42 and 61 certifications - a credibility advantage. Its filter life is shorter at 3,000 gallons, and the one-year warranty is less generous than Alexapure's five-year coverage. Propur also lacks the brand recognition and community of Berkey, though it has a loyal following among certification-focused buyers.

The Alexapure Pro occupies a clear niche: it costs less than Berkey when fluoride removal is factored in, matches Propur on price while offering longer filter life, and provides a solid warranty. Its primary disadvantage is the slower flow rate and inability to add multiple elements for increased throughput.

How does the Alexapure Pro compare to Brita or PUR pitcher filters?

The Alexapure Pro is in a completely different performance category from standard pitcher filters. Pitcher filters like Brita and PUR primarily reduce chlorine and some particulates, with limited heavy metal removal and no bacterial or viral protection. The Alexapure Pro filters bacteria, viruses, lead, fluoride, pharmaceuticals, and 200+ additional contaminants. The trade-off is price ($279 vs. $25-35), size (countertop unit vs. refrigerator pitcher), and speed (1 GPH gravity filtration vs. instant pour-through).

Can I use the Alexapure Pro with well water?

Yes, the Alexapure Pro is commonly used with well water and is effective against bacteria, cysts, sediment, and many chemical contaminants found in untreated groundwater sources. However, if your well water has high levels of dissolved solids (TDS), nitrates, or specific minerals, you should have your water tested first. Gravity filters do not reduce TDS or nitrates effectively - a reverse osmosis system may be more appropriate for those specific contaminants.

How do I clean and maintain the Alexapure Pro?

Maintenance involves three main tasks. First, clean the ceramic filter surface every 2-3 months (or when flow slows) by gently scrubbing under running water with a clean scouring pad - do not use soap. Second, wash the stainless steel chambers monthly with warm soapy water and rinse thoroughly. Third, replace the filter element every 5,000 gallons or 12 months. No other maintenance is required, and the unit has no moving parts or electronic components that can fail.
